## Authentication

Matchbox (the pairing service) exposes GC pause metrics at `/internal/gc`. Pauses over 400ms page on-call. The endpoint is behind the Kestrelgate proxy; anonymous calls return 403. Auth is a static service key in the `X-Matchbox-Key` header — no OAuth, no refresh. Keys rotate quarterly; stale keys fail closed, which looks identical to a network partition, so check auth first. The current on-call key for the GC metrics endpoint is below.

API key for kahap-faduf: vxb23-Ir087IkWYmBJt7KRtkyhUA3

Reviewer note: the Calverton CI job fails on the date-localization branch because the Broma formatter caches locale data between test shards. Shard 3 inherits the wrong month names from shard 2's Tillish locale run. Fix is to reset the formatter in the suite teardown, not to pin the locale globally — that masks the bug. Confirm the snapshot updates only touch the affected fixtures before approving. Reproduce locally with the cache flag disabled. The failing run's trace token appears below.

build token for kagaf-hahof: htk14_9d3d4d26d7d8de

The deep-link router ships as part of the gateway bundle and is deployed via the standard blue-green flow. Routing tables are compiled at build time, but environment-specific behavior (scheme prefixes, fallback web host, universal-link verification mode) is read from the runtime config service at startup. After the last sync we agreed to pin these per environment rather than inherit defaults, since staging kept resolving links against prod pages. The current pinned values for the staging environment are listed below.

service settings:
[silwyn]
host = silwyn.crelvogrid.internal
user = silwyn_svc
database = silwyn_prod

The Brightmoor gateway wraps all calls to the upstream Vextal API in a circuit breaker. It trips after ten consecutive failures within thirty seconds, stays open for one minute, then half-opens with a single probe request. Thresholds live in the gateway config repo; change them only via review. For access to that repo or questions about tuning, reach the platform team here.

alerts address for baguf-yagep: ralax_eliox@lumicsys.corp